Microsoft has announced the launch of one of the most anticipated games of the year, Gears of Wars: Judgment, the fourth instalment in the popular Gears of War series.

The Gears of War: Judgment story unveils through a series of flashbacks. It is played from the perspective of the Kilo Squad, led by tech-geek Damon Baird, as they battle ferocious new enemies with an expanded arsenal of weapons. As war rages around them, the entire Kilo Squad including the flamboyant Augustus The Cole Train Cole is put on trial. Gamers can experience first-hand the events that led up to their court-martial as the events are recounted during the trial - how the Kilo Squad struggles to fight off the Locust horde, as they burst from the ground on Emergence Day, led by a terrifying new Locust Leader: General Karn.

The OverRun mode allows gamers to form five-player teams that take turns at pitting Locust and COG soldiers in a head-to-head battle. If players want to up the ante and make the game more difficult, there is an option to do just that. One can increase the difficulty level by declassifying critical information with the new Declassified Testimony system. By declassifying testimony within the course of the campaign, weapons and alternate scenarios will be unlocked and change the way enemies are fought against going forward.

Gears of Wars: Judgment is now available for Xbox 360 for Rs. 2,999.

Gears of Wars originally released in November 2006 on the Xbox. It is one of the most popular franchises in Xbox history, having sold more than 18 million games worldwide.
